The Roastery Coffee House  

Category: Coffee & Tea

4 star rating
 9/19/2008   First to Review
The Roastery provides an appreciated alternative to the poorly-laid-out Starbucks or hit-or-miss Le Gourmand coffee, but they're more than just a coffee joint.  They do tasty and affordable foodstuffs too.

Between the decent coffee, the smiling staff and the healthy lunch choices, this is my number one weekday lunchtime escape when I'm feeling that 9 to 5 rut.  

Hello, high ceilings.  Hi there, big windows.  Obama-bump, free wifi!

La Fromagerie  

Category: Cheese Shops
Neighbourhood: Dufferin Grove

4 star rating
 9/18/2008   First to Review
If you're looking for a delicious and flaky almond croissant but don't want to venture into the obnoxious stretch of Little Italy to find it, head to La Fromagerie.  Make sure to bring a friend/food-chaperon along with you, one who has promised to hurt you if you try to make a break for it with that easy-to-carry croissant basket in tow.  Trust me, you'll feel your animal instincts kick in when you taste those bad boys.

Tip: Since they place their pastries in the window, they sell out quickly, so go early to avoid gut-wrenching heartbreak.

I've heard complaints that the owners are snobby grumps...  I've never had a problem, but even if I had, it's College & Oz, who cares!  

This can't be a complete review without mentioning the cheeses:  They sell cheeses.  I've never bought any.
